I have just recently got a 96 plymouth breeze, all the reg maintenance has been kept up, and the only major problem that was ever wrong with it was a blown head gasket, when it was not even a year old, and that was all fixed under warranty by the dealership the car was bought brand new off the dealer showroom at the time with 0 miles, and it was a one owner car, has there been any problems with this type of car that anybody knows of or will this be a pretty dependable car.... it only has a little over 70,000 miles on it..

My 97 Stratus (same car as Breeze) has 144,500 miles (2.4L engine). The only problem has been a blown head gasket fixed under warranty. Other than that, great car. I just took it on a 6000 mile vacation from Florida to Utah. Averaged 32MPG, and used less than 1 quart of oil. I've been extremely happy with the car.
